Answer:According to American Medical Association the doctors in the U.S recommends limiting LEDs to 3,000k due to harmful effects of LEDs more than 3,000k.

LEDs up to 3,000k are considered to be safest. LEDs more than that can have harmful impacts on our health. LEDs less than 3,000 or up to that are beneficial in two ways.
- They are economical
- They are energy efficient.
But LEDs more than that are really bad, they create a harsh glare and makes it difficult for us to see. There are many health risks also like it disturbs our sleep.
These lights badly affect our environment and various species in it. So it is safest to use LEDs up to 3,000k, not more than that due to risks associated.
